ACCC Competition for Choral Writing
The Association of Canadian Choral Communities encourages and supports the composition of new choral works by Canadian composers.
The competition provides:
- $1,500 prize
- Publication of the winning work
- Winning work to be performed by the National Youth Choir at Podium 2012, May 17–20, Ottawa, Ontario
Guidelines for 2012
Open to Canadian citizens and landed immigrants
Entry deadline: October 1, 2011
Entry fee: $25.00
Duration of the work: 2—5 minutes
Type of work: Original composition for SATB (a cappella or piano accompaniment)
